ITEM 5.02 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ers

Resignation of Director

Daniel A. Ninivaggi has indicated his intent to resign as a director of Icahn Enterprises L.P. (“Icahn Enterprises”) prior to the closing of its acquisition of Uni-Select USA, Inc. Mr. Ninivaggi will continue to serve as a director and Co-Chief Executive Officer of Federal-Mogul Holdings Corporation (NASDAQ: FDML), a subsidiary of Icahn Enterprises and a leading global supplier of products and services to the world's manufacturers and servicers of vehicles and equipment in the automotive, light, medium and heavy-duty commercial, marine, rail, aerospace, power generation and industrial markets.
